

The rolling hills of the Sierra de Aracena, 100 kms north west of Seville, provide perfect walking country. Tracks connect the pretty white villages and these ancient caminos offer gentle walking through a great variety of landscape. Lush secret valleys, past abandoned farms lost in tangles of aromatic cistus and rock roses and along the high ridges with far distant views of hills crowned with Templar castles or remains of the C10th Moorish Caliphate.
